I am on my macbook, I am upgrading from Ubuntu 12.10 to 13.04. The upgrade went fine, Up until about half way, Where it just stopped. No error message, And it is no frozen. Nothing is happening, It just says installed cabextract.

If you managed to download all the files, and that it hanged under the installation, there is still a solution to re-take it.

When that happened to me earlier, I tried to run sudo apt-get -f install, and it just started where it had stopped. Please correct me if i am wrong readers!

And, the software updater will automatically detect if there is aproblem in the database, and it will ask you to run a "partial" upgrade.
